From da18ac3a0f5e75ab4d844a533d3d6f918b24b2a4 Mon Sep 17 00:00:00 2001 From: Toyohisa Kameyama Date: Thu, 3 Oct 2019 02:55:05 +0900 Subject: cdhit: add zlib dependency. (#13015) * cdhit: add zlib dependency. * Add zlib variant. --- var/spack/repos/builtin/packages/cdhit/package.py |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) diff --git a/var/spack/repos/builtin/packages/cdhit/package.py b/var/spack/repos/builtin/packages/cdhit/package.py index f2c1d78b6f..0f5172bfc1 100644 --- a/var/spack/repos/builtin/packages/cdhit/package.py +++ b/var/spack/repos/builtin/packages/cdhit/package.py @@ -17,15 +17,19 @@ class Cdhit(MakefilePackage): version('4.6.8', 'bdd73ec0cceab6653aab7b31b57c5a8b') variant('openmp', default=True, description='Compile with multi-threading support') + variant('zlib', default=True, description='Compile with zlib') depends_on('perl', type=('build', 'run')) + depends_on('zlib', when='+zlib', type='link') def build(self, spec, prefix): mkdirp(prefix.bin) + make_args = [] if '~openmp' in spec: - make('openmp=no') - else: - make() + make_args.append('openmp=no') + if '~zlib' in spec: + make_args.append('zlib=no') + make(*make_args) def setup_environment(self, spack_env, run_env): spack_env.set('PREFIX', prefix.bin) -- cgit v1.2.3-60-g2f50